Check the transformer in the AHU - it is possible that it is underrated or failing. Mine only does it during the winter months with the heat on. I discovered that the filter was dirty enough to reduce the air flow across the heat exchanger. This was causing them to over heat, and restart the system.

Ecobee says it expects its thermostats to last 10 to 15 years. Google Nest declined to give a time frame when we contacted them but said the average thermostat lasts 8 to 10 years, and the Nest is expected to meet that average. In either case, that is long past the warranty. Looks like the ecobee is able to bring on the heat for an it, but then the restart kicks in. This probably isn't a voltage issues, if it was we'd see the ecobee restart Instantly and no data would be showing up on the Home IQ. Your thermostat is being set up for the first …The software program loaded in Ecobee is designed to calibrate automatically the first time it is launched or when the device restarts; this process typically takes five up to 20 minutes. Therefore, the “Calibrating” sign on the display of your Ecobee thermostat shows that it is currently assessing the present internal temperature.

There are three reasons why an Ecobee thermostat may be rebooting often: The wiring to the thermostat is damaged, loose, or installed incorrectly. The furnace is overheating. The HVAC unit needs to be cleaned or serviced. Your Ecobee rebooting every once in a while may not seem like a big deal, but it can become inconvenient if it keeps happening.Problem. Investigate Threshold settings On the thermostat 1. Check the fuses. It is not uncommon for fuses to blow after a power outage. For this reason, if your Ecobee stops working after a power outage, the first thing to check should be the fuse on the furnace control board. Open the furnace control panel to expose where your furnace wires are connected, and check the fuse to see if it is intact.

The ecobee calibrates again if there’s any type of outage, whether a switch is turned off or an outage is caused by bad weather or faulty wiring. Whatever the case, an ecobee’s screen may go black and power off and on again, leading to a “calibrating” message.
